色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

ajax動態(tài)跳轉(zhuǎn)html頁面內(nèi)容

宋博文1年前7瀏覽0評論
動態(tài)跳轉(zhuǎn)HTML頁面是通過AJAX實現(xiàn)的一種前端技術(shù)。它可以實現(xiàn)在不刷新整個頁面的情況下,通過改變頁面內(nèi)容而實現(xiàn)頁面的跳轉(zhuǎn)。這種技術(shù)在Web開發(fā)中被廣泛應(yīng)用,為用戶提供了更好的交互體驗。下面將詳細介紹AJAX動態(tài)跳轉(zhuǎn)HTML頁面的實現(xiàn)原理和實例應(yīng)用。 在AJAX動態(tài)跳轉(zhuǎn)HTML頁面中,主要的實現(xiàn)原理是利用JavaScript中的XMLHttpRequest對象和DOM操作。當用戶點擊頁面鏈接或觸發(fā)其他事件時,JavaScript代碼通過XMLHttpRequest對象向服務(wù)器發(fā)送請求,服務(wù)器返回相應(yīng)的HTML內(nèi)容。然后,JavaScript代碼通過DOM操作將新的HTML內(nèi)容插入到頁面中的特定位置,從而實現(xiàn)頁面的跳轉(zhuǎn)和內(nèi)容更新。 舉個例子來說明,假設(shè)我們的網(wǎng)站有一個導航欄,其中包含了幾個鏈接,點擊不同的鏈接可以跳轉(zhuǎn)到不同的頁面。傳統(tǒng)的做法是點擊鏈接后,服務(wù)器返回整個新頁面的HTML內(nèi)容,整個頁面會進行刷新。而使用AJAX動態(tài)跳轉(zhuǎn)HTML頁面的方法,我們只需要服務(wù)器返回部分HTML內(nèi)容,然后通過JavaScript代碼只更新頁面中的某個特定元素,而不是整個頁面。這樣,用戶就無需等待整個頁面的刷新,而是可以快速地瀏覽新的頁面內(nèi)容。 下面我們來看一段使用AJAX動態(tài)跳轉(zhuǎn)HTML頁面的代碼示例。假設(shè)我們有一個網(wǎng)頁中包含一個按鈕,點擊按鈕后需要跳轉(zhuǎn)到另一個頁面并顯示新的內(nèi)容。首先,我們需要給該按鈕綁定一個點擊事件的監(jiān)聽器,當按鈕被點擊時發(fā)送請求到服務(wù)器獲取新的頁面內(nèi)容。 ```html``` 上述代碼中,我們首先獲取了一個按鈕元素,并通過addEventListener方法為其綁定了一個點擊事件的監(jiān)聽器。當按鈕被點擊時,JavaScript代碼會執(zhí)行,創(chuàng)建一個XMLHttpRequest對象并發(fā)送一個GET請求到服務(wù)器。當請求的狀態(tài)改變時,我們判斷請求是否成功,如果成功則獲取服務(wù)器返回的HTML內(nèi)容,并通過innerHTML屬性更新頁面中id為"content"的元素的內(nèi)容。 通過這樣的方式,我們可以實現(xiàn)網(wǎng)頁的動態(tài)跳轉(zhuǎn)和內(nèi)容更新,而無需刷新整個頁面。這種技術(shù)在一些單頁面應(yīng)用中尤為有用,可以提供更好的用戶體驗。 綜上所述,AJAX動態(tài)跳轉(zhuǎn)HTML頁面是一種前端技術(shù),通過XMLHttpRequest對象和DOM操作實現(xiàn)頁面的快速跳轉(zhuǎn)和內(nèi)容更新。它大大提升了用戶的交互體驗,使得網(wǎng)頁的操作更加流暢和高效。無論是單頁面應(yīng)用,還是普通的網(wǎng)站,都可以借助AJAX動態(tài)跳轉(zhuǎn)HTML頁面來提升用戶體驗。